Noco chargers are not fast not even remotely, Using the 26Amp Noco on a 115 Amp Battery Vs a 10Amp standard type charger and the Standard Charger will Blitz the 26A Noco,
How do I know this ? because I own the Noco G3500 / 3.5A charger and the G15000 / 15Amp Charger and the G26000 / 26Amp Charger, All three of them are very slow indeed
IE, I hooked up the G15000 to the 115A/h battery to charge it and it took 8 and a half hours to get to 90% where the Main Green Light was flashing and by time it had finished doing what it had to do once the Green light came On fully the charger sat there clicking away equalizing the battery and by time it had finished over 39 hours had gone by,
I spoke to Noco and I got a heap of Techno babble which was totally BS, As I have 3 new batteries and on each battery the results were the same, Anyway I don't know how they can claim that they are twice as fast on a 100/120 Ah battery claiming it takes 3.8 hours to charge a Deep cycle Lead Acid Battery Because the quickest I have seen the Green LED light up fully is 6 and a half hour, and my Big Normal charger on the 9Amp setting will charge the same battery in 3h 30m up to 4h 37m.
The only thing Noco chargers are good for is leaving batteries permanently on charge along with being able to charge many different battery technologies, I just don't see a real world purpose for Noco Chargers apart for leaving a battery on charge forever.
